Can I cook asparagus vegetable oil?
Yes, you can cook asparagus in vegetable oil. Here's a simple recipe for roasted asparagus with vegetable oil:
Ingredients:
- Asparagus spears (fresh or frozen)
- Vegetable oil
- Salt
- Pepper
Instructions:
1. Preheat your oven to 425 degrees Fahrenheit (220 degrees Celsius).
2. Clean the asparagus spears by trimming the tough ends.
3. Toss the asparagus with a little bit of vegetable oil, salt, and pepper.
4. Arrange the asparagus on a baking sheet and roast in the preheated oven for 10-15 minutes, or until tender and slightly browned.
Asparagus spears can be cooked in a variety of oils, including olive oil, coconut oil, and avocado oil. Each oil will impart a slightly different flavor to the asparagus, so feel free to experiment and find your favorite combination.
